Yes. This happens because floating point arithmetic is not associative, ie, (a + b) + c ≠ a + (b + c).

On a GPU, you may have values a, b, and c calculated in parallel and then summed in the order that they’re “ready”. E.g., if they’re returned in the order a, b, c, you’d get:

sum = a + b 

sum += c

but if they’re returned in the order b, c, a, you’d get:

sum = b + c  

sum += a

those two sums can be slightly different because of floating point rounding. 

In LLM calculations, you have billions of FLOPs per forward pass. Even when temperature = 0, if the top two most-probable tokens are close in probability, these rounding differences can change the order of the most-probable tokens, resulting in slightly different answers. 

Consider the fact that LLMs are autoregressive as well, so if this happens and changes any token, then all tokens after it will be altered.

Note that this is a software problem. It’s possible to make GPUs deterministic, but they’d be less efficient. In the example above, you could wait until a, b, and c were all ready and always sum in the same order.
